Microplastics & Nanoplastics in Drinking Water: What You Need to Know

The concern surrounding microplastics and nanoplastics has never been greater. Thanks to a breakthrough in scientific research, scientists can now detect thousands of microscopic plastic particles in ordinary bottled drinking water.

Researchers at Columbia University recently developed an advanced detection technique called Stimulated Raman Scattering (SRS), allowing them to identify both microplastics and nanoplastics with unprecedented precision.

The Science Behind FllexiBott's 2-Stage Filtration

When we say that FllexiFitt filters contaminants from water down to 0.2 microns, it’s easy to recognize that it’s small, but understanding how small that is, is important.  A micron, or micrometer, is one-millionth of a meter. To put that into perspective, a single human hair is roughly 70 microns wide.
